Insurance Copayments
The fixed out-of-pocket amount paid by an insured for covered services, in addition to any insurance-covered portion.
Physician Fees
are the charges or payments required for medical services provided by a doctor or medical specialist.
Malpractice Insurance Premiums
Payments made to insure against claims of negligence or inadequacy by professionals, especially in the medical field.
Defensive Medicine
Practice by healthcare providers who order tests, procedures, or visits, or avoid certain high-risk patients or procedures, primarily to reduce litigation risk, rather than to further the patient's health.
